#3093c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3093cd is composed of 18.8% red, 57.6%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 28.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 202.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#3093cd color hex could be obtained by blending #60ffff with #00279b.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3093c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3093cd has RGB values of R:48, G:147,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3183565.

Shades and Tints of #3093c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a0e is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3093cd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7f7f is the less saturated color, while #099df4 is the most saturated one.
